This document lists various 10-code numbers used in walkie talkie communications along with their meanings. Some codes indicate receiving strength, transmitting status, relaying messages, requesting repeats or clarification. Others relate to locations, requests to contact others by phone, reporting emergencies, requesting assistance from police, fire or medical services. The codes provide concise ways to communicate essential information over radios.
